## Tuning

The Quillgate transcode farm scales workers per queue depth. Defaults assume mixed 1080p loads; 4K-heavy batches need lower concurrency and bigger scratch volumes. Change values only via release config, never on live nodes, and confirm against the soak-test baseline before shipping. Release builds must match the constants listed below.

constants for tafog-kahag:
RATE_LIMITS = {
    "sorir": 697,
    "oliox": 683,
    "holax": 176,
    "casox": 60,
    "pelius": 382,
}

## Changelog — Ticktrace 1.9

### Renamed: DRIFT_API_TOKEN
During the cron drift investigation we found plugins confusing this variable with the metrics token, so it has been renamed to indicate it authorizes drift-report uploads specifically. Plugin authors must read the new name from 1.9 onward; the old name is ignored without warning. Sample env files in the SDK are updated. In your deployment env file, the drift-report upload secret is set on the next line.

env line for fawef-taguf: VAULT_KEY13=a9695905a9a90

If suggestions stop rendering, first confirm the widget's region parameter matches the tenant's locale, then check Lanefinder's health endpoint before assuming a quota issue. Keys are scoped per environment; a staging key used in production returns empty results rather than errors, which is the most common on-call trap. The production key currently in rotation is listed here for quick verification:

API key for yahig-tadup: kto7_ubizbYm